Cell C is becoming the biggest aggregator of network capacity and we are using our own spectrum to carry traffic through access to a virtualised radio access network ( RAN ) provisioned by our network infrastructure partner . We are bidding for spectrum later this year and are already in discussions with our roaming partners and close to the implementation of 5G services for our customers .
Which telecoms equipment vendors is Cell C South Africa working with to roll-out its 5G network ?
As mentioned earlier , we are leveraging off our roaming partners for the access component of the telecoms value chain . Huawei is our incumbent technology partner on our core and billing systems .
Talk us through what the rollout of 5G will mean for Cell C customers and what sort of services and experiences can they expect from your company that they are currently not getting ?
As an industry , we need to be cautious in creating an expectation that a 5G network will be rolled out as quickly as 4G and 3G networks because the frequencies used in 5G is much higher , which means it doesn ’ t reach as far . What I mean by that is , in order to cover the same area as 3G and 4G networks , there will need to be many more 5G sites to cover the same geographical area .
The first use case for 5G would be fixed wireless access service for customers – areas where there isn ’ t a fibre footprint the solution would be to deploy 5G fixed wire access . Another use case , which is in the future , we will see automation in various industries with delicate remote procedures made possible due to the low latency of 5G . Internet of Things ( IoT ) technologies will also become more prevalent due to the ability of 5G to support a lot more connections and devices at a given point in time .
